What is the Between Normal Switch and Manageable Switch?..

Answer / arunachalam

Manageable Switch has lots of features like Vlan Creations, Port Security, Priorities traffics, IGMP Snooping(To prevent Multicast messages), Port Mirroring, Rate Limiting/Rate setting, Link aggregation.

But in Unmanageable these activities cannot possible. It just pass the traffic, Whatever it may be....

What is the Between Normal Switch and Manageable Switch?..

Answer / satyam

A managed switch gives you the ability to log into the
network switch and monitor and configure each port on the
switch one by one. An unmanaged switch does not give you
this ability.A managed switch will be much more expensive
than an unmanaged switch of the same size.
